Michael Conforto Signs One-Year Deal with Los Angeles Dodgers

December 9 – Outfielder Michael Conforto has agreed to a one-year, $17 million contract with the Los Angeles Dodgers, according to reports from ESPN and The Athletic on Sunday night. The move adds another proven veteran to the Dodgers’ already stacked lineup as the reigning World Series champions look to bolster their roster for another title run.

Conforto’s Recent Performance

Conforto, 31, comes off a productive season with the San Francisco Giants, where he played 130 games and posted a .237 batting average, along with 20 home runs and 66 RBIs. Despite a slightly lower batting average, Conforto showcased his ability to deliver power and consistency in key moments, proving he still has plenty to offer at the plate.

Career Highlights

An All-Star in 2017, Conforto brings a wealth of experience to the Dodgers, having played 1,012 major league games across nine seasons. His career statistics include a .251 batting average, 167 home runs, and 520 RBIs, accumulated during his time with the New York Mets (2015-2021) and Giants (2023-2024).

Conforto made his MLB debut with the Mets in 2015 and quickly established himself as a reliable hitter with both power and versatility. He played a key role in the Mets’ 2015 postseason run, hitting two home runs in Game 4 of the World Series.

What Conforto Brings to the Dodgers

The addition of Conforto provides the Dodgers with a seasoned left-handed hitter capable of playing all three outfield positions. His power at the plate and experience in high-pressure games make him a valuable asset for Los Angeles as they aim to defend their championship in 2024.

The Dodgers are known for their ability to maximize the potential of veteran players, and Conforto’s proven track record suggests he could thrive in their system. With this move, the Dodgers further solidify their lineup, creating additional depth and flexibility as they prepare for the upcoming season.
